CHAMP : CHLAMYDIA / GC, AMPLIFIED PROBE

Test Discontinued. Order code: CNGAM

Methodology:
Isothermal amplification of Chlamydia trachomatis/Neisseria gonorrhea rRNA via a transcription-mediated assay (TMA).

SPECIMEN REQUIRED:

Collect:
Urethral or cervical specimen in Gen-Probe Swab Colletion Kit (male or female). For urine samples, the patient should not have urinated for at least one hour prior to sampling. Instruct the patient to collect the first 20-30 mL of the urine stream in a urine cup. Larger volumes may dilute specimen. Female patients should not cleanse the labial area prior to collection.

Transport:
Send urethral or cervical specimen in Gen-Probe Swab Colletion Kit (male or female) at 2-30°C. For urine samples, send 2 mL first void urine in urine chlamydia/GC transport vial (fill within the two black lines on the side of the tube) at 2-30°C.

Stability:
Genital:  30 days at 2-30°C.  Urine: 30 days at 2-30°C.
Urine specimens can be transported to the laboratory at 2-30°C in the urine cup or the urine specimen transport tube.   Urine specimens must be transferred into the specimen transport tube within 24 hours of collection.
